4. Athens: The Capital of Culture

Source of Image

Athens is the capital of Greece and serves as the heart of Ancient Greece, a formidable civilization and empire of its era. Landmarks from the 5th century BC, including the Acropolis, a citadel situated atop a hill adorned with ancient structures like the colonnaded Parthenon temple, still reign over the city. Several museums like the Acropolis Museum, in addition to the National Archaeological Museum, safeguard sculptures, jewelry, and more from Ancient Greece.

Is February a good time to visit Greece?

Greece in February is cool with gray skies and plenty of rain. There are plenty of good places to enjoy some winter sun and attractions without the crowds.

How hot is Greece in February?

The average temperature in February is around 10°C – with lows of 7°C and highs of 13°C. The average daily sunshine in February is just four hours, higher than January.
